Abstract

Worldwide, Gerhard Andersson is one of the most influential researchers working on internet-based psychological treatments. Moreover, he is also one of the leading researchers in the field of psychologically oriented tinnitus research. He is full professor of clinical psychology at Linkoping University and affiliated professor at the Karolinska Institute in Stockholm at the Department of Clinical Neuroscience, Section Psychiatry. Professor Andersson has been highly productive, having produced more the 300 scientific papers. During his whole career he has worked part-time with patients. Apart from his own research and clinical work, Professor Andersson has editorial responsibilities for several journals including Cognitive Behaviour Therapy, Plos One, BMC Psychiatry, and Scandinavian Journal of Psychology. The interview was conducted by Professor Thomas Berger.
